How do I convert 1,737,901 mAh to Wh?
Multiply 1,737,901 by the battery voltage, then divide by 1,000. At 3.7V: 1,737,901 × 3.7 / 1,000 = 6,430.2337 Wh.
Is 1,737,901 mAh allowed on a plane?
At 3.7V, 1,737,901 mAh = 6,430.2337 Wh. Airlines allow lithium batteries up to 100 Wh in carry-on luggage. Batteries between 100–160 Wh require airline approval. Batteries over 160 Wh are prohibited on passenger aircraft.
